When a Pairing Cannot Occur with the Bluetooth-compatible Device or the
Bluetooth-compatible Device Does Not Behave (Bluetooth Headset Connection
Type)
An appropriate Headset Profile connection sequence exists for each of the Bluetooth-compatible devices (headsets) to be
connected with the transceiver by using Headset Profile. For the transceiver, an appropriate Headset Profile connection
sequence needs to be configured in Bluetooth Headset Connection Type according to the Bluetooth-compatible device
to be used.
By using KPG-D1/ D1N, Bluetooth Headset Connection Type can be configured.
The following Bluetooth-compatible devices are guaranteed to behave properly.
Table 10-8 Bluetooth Headset Connection Type
Configuration Description
Headset 1
The following Bluetooth-compatible devices can be used normally:
Manufactured by Plantronics:
Voyager Legend
Manufactured by Pryme:
BTH-LMIC
BTH-300
BTH-600
Manufactured by 3M:
Peltor WS Headset XP
Peltor WS ProTac XP
Manufactured by Sensear:
SM1x Smart Muff-HB
SPx Smart Plug
Manufactured by Savox:
BTR-155 Radio (K551061)
Headset 2
The following Bluetooth-compatible devices can be used normally:
Manufactured by Plantronics:
Voyager Legend
Manufactured by Pryme:
BT-LMIC
BTH-LMIC
Manufactured by 3M:
Peltor WS Headset XP
Peltor WS ProTac XP
Manufactured by Sensear:
SM1x Smart Muff-HB
SPx Smart Plug
Also, the Headset Profile connection sequence can be changed by selecting “Headset 1” or “Headset 2” after placing the
transceiver in Menu Mode by pressing the Menu
key and executing “Bluetooth Headset Connection Type”.
(Refer to Using Menu Mode.)
Note
Bluetooth-compatible devices with different connection sequences may not be connected even if either “Headset 1” or
“Headset 2” is configured in Bluetooth Headset Connection Type.
